Our issue is that we purchased a domain name from SAV, but they have it on a "clientHold" status -
We contacted support, but they have claimed that we should be able to use the domain with our own DNS, which is not true -- DNSIMPLE told us that we can't use the domain as long as a registrar has it on "clientHold".

At this point we need to do a formal complaint with ICANN, a "better business bureau" complaint in Illinois (seems SAV is an Illinois corporation)? Following that we need to track down who actually owns this busines and actually sue them.

It looks like this request was posted on 3 different NP threads which is a bit unnecessary. clientHold is not a scam but instead typically means that the link in the WHOIS Contact Verification email was not clicked so the domain was disabled per ICANN. We bought a new domain with my friend yesterday from Sav, first time. But the nameservers change is taking too long. How long it takes on Sav to change nameservers? On namecheap it took less than a hour.

Are you referring to when the registrar accepts the nameserver request or to the propagation of the nameservers across the internet?

If you are referring to the former, the change should be almost instant (at least it was for the last 10 domains or so I registered with them)

If you are referring to the latter, it might take up to 48 hrs to fully propagate
